Episode Date: October 19, 2020TALKING WALKING DEAD: FEAR AND BEYOND FEAR THE WALKING DEAD SEASON ONE EPISODE TWO TITLED: Welcome to the Club Today THIS IS TALKING WALKING DEAD With myself Jeff Fisher, Jason Buttrill & Maximus Fi...sher EPISODE DESCRIPTION ON IMDB FEAR Virginia forces Alicia and Strand to clear an unusual walker threat, where an encounter with a new ally gives Strand an idea that could be the key to their freedom.
